0:00 15:00 minutes o SW play warm up lines 1-3


o TW award stars for correct answers about rhythm/ counting
Warm-up Sheet o TW review eighth note counting on line 4
o SW play line 4
o TW repeat process for lines 5 and 6

15:00 45:00 minutes o SW look at Bb scale on back of warm-up sheet


o TW discuss/ write full scale on board
Concert Bb Scale
o TW write new fingerings on board, circle notes on sheet
o TW check individual students fingerings
o SW play individual notes
o TW model whole scale on clarinet, SW say and finger note
names along
o SW play through scale in whole notes

45:00- 60:00 minutes


o #45- TW write one measure of rhythm on board
Red Book Exercises o SW volunteer to write counting
o SW count in time
o SW count and clap rhythm
o SW tizzle and finger rhythm
o SW play rhythm on line #45
o TW repeat process for line #47

0:00 5:00 minutes o SW play F stretches in whole notes (ascending and


descending)
F Stretches

5:00 30:00 minutes o SW play Bb, Eb, F concert scales (review)


o TW review any missed fingerings, key signature, etc.
Concert Ab Scale o TW award stars for correct key signature answers
o TW write/ discuss concert Ab scale on board
o SW circle new notes on scale sheet
o TW teach new scale in groups of 4-5 notes at a time, played
in whole notes
o SW say note names and finger in time
o TW model on Clarinet while students are saying note names
and fingering along
o SW play scale ascending, then descending, then whole scale
in whole notes

30:00- 60:00 minutes


o #92- SW attempt to pass off
Red Book Exercises o TW teach rhythms and notes in 92, 2 measures at a time
o TW review notes and counting with students on board, taking
student volunteers and awarding stars (saying, tizzling,
fingering)
o #93, 98- TW repeat if time permits
